The NZ Govt has decided on a massive economic package. We don't have community transmission yet, but tourism is a massive industry for us and is going to all-but-disappear for a while. So this package is aimed at helping small businesses stay afloat and pay wages and providing improved support to the poorest and the about-to-be unemployed. Also more money for healthcare. The package is worth 4% of GDP and there are more measures to come.
This is the direct opposite of the kind of austerity, monetary policy and tax cut economics we have had for the last 35 years. It shouldn't have required a crisis of this magnitude but it's a relief and will help us get back up once the worst has passed.

I have a *wild* hope.
The first case detected of this was traced as far back as 17 Nov.
The Wuhan lockdown was 23 Jan.
It is not impossible that the virus was wandering around infecting people for many days before detection.
But even between detection and lockdown, we're looking at 70 or more days.
If it doubles every three days, that's 23 doubling times - into the millions. Wuhan's population is 11 million.
Early estimates based on case fatalities were that hundreds of thousands were infected, but we've learned an awful lot more about how many can spread asymptomatically now.
So my desperate hope at this point is that Wuhan's lockdown came high into the peak, and stopped it spreading to the rest of China - but Wuhan itself was already past the peak.
That's my desperate hope anyway. We won't know for quite a while. There is no test for who has antibodies for this, yet. It would change everything if there were.

I think any country hitting an inflection point in the curve during the next few weeks will be the result of improved containment measures rather than the purely mathematical reason a classic logistic curve does - which is when you begin to run out of fresh people to infect. I think that even though the true numbers of cases are much higher than the reported (known) numbers, we're still nowhere near the level that will cause the doubling rate to slow without enhanced containment.
